Geneva Finance reports $8.6m profit turnaround
via autotalk.co.nzGeneva Finance Group has reported an unaudited pretax profit of $8.6 million for the nine months ended 31 December 2025, representing a $2.9 million improvement on the prior year. The automotive and personal finance company says the year-on-year improvement reflects stronger performance across the group, underpinned by disciplined execution and operational progress. Auto Trader NZ achieves record monthly lead volume
via autotalk.co.nzAutoTrader New Zealand has reported record-breaking performance in January 2026, with the platform generating more than 12,000 leads – its highest monthly lead volume on record. The online automotive marketplace says post-holiday buyer demand surged during January, driving increased traffic and engagement across the platform. Holden Commodore
Of the 79 LGAs in Victoria, the Holden Commodore was the most stolen vehicle in 26 of them.
